"I'm not sure of the exact year when women started deploying down south. I did my summer support tours (3) in 1988, 1989 and 1990/91. Women by the time I started were well established in McMurdo as well as smaller bases. "
"I was assigned to NSFA from August 1988 to October 1991. I did 3 summer support deployments to Antarctica. I worked in the Personnel Office. Some of the best years of my life. Fantastic duty station."
